ObsEva SA: Nasdaq/NYSE listing notice — ObsEva restructures, cuts 57% workforce, delists from Nasdaq, retires $6.5M debt, CEO replaced
ObsEva SA
- Workforce reduced ~57%; restructuring charges ~$1.2M; annual savings ~$3.5M.
- CEO Brian O'Callaghan stepped down; CFO Will Brown appointed Interim CEO; other executives departed.
- Board members not standing for re-election; Founder Ernest Loumaye to be nominated Chairman.
- Retired $6.5M convertible debt with JGB; paid $565,614 cash + 1.47M shares; JGB waived $1.1M penalty.
- Nasdaq delisting expected; intends to deregister with SEC; will maintain SIX Swiss Exchange listing.

On February 23, 2023, the Board of Directors (the “Board”) of the Company approved a reorganization plan, to, among other things, consolidate its operations in Switzerland, where its headquarters are located. The reorganization plan is intended to preserve cash, focus resources towards the development of nolasiban, a novel, oral oxytocin receptor agonist to improve in vitro fertilization success rates, and manage out-licensed programs. As part of the reorganization, the Company reduced its overall workforce by approximately 57%, including downsizing its US-based executive management team. The Company expects to similarly propose a reduced Board at its next Annual General Meeting of Shareholders (the “AGM”). The Company is beginning the activities with respect to the reorganization plan effective immediately.
